Usages of enkisuru
彼 は 緊急 の 連絡 を 受けて、 会議 を 延期しました。kare wa kinkyuu no renraku o ukete, kaigi o enkishimashita.
He received an urgent message and postponed the meeting.
都合 が 悪い なら、 会議 を 延期しましょう。tsugou ga warui nara, kaigi o enkishimashou.
If it’s inconvenient, let’s postpone the meeting.

“How do verb conjugations work in Japanese?”
Japanese verbs conjugate based on tense, politeness, and mood. For example, the polite present form adds ‑ます to the verb stem, while the past tense uses ‑ました. Unlike English, Japanese verbs don't change based on the subject — the same form works for "I", "you", and "they".
